Description
The Martinez Pintada Ranch lies 30 miles southwest of Santa Rosa at the foot of the picturesque Argonne Mesa in Guadalupe County. This expansive property includes 8,976 acres of deeded land, complemented by 5,643 acres New Mexico state lease and 1,280 acres BLM lease, totaling 15,899 acres. Owned and managed by the Martinez family since 1920, this marks the first time this ranch has been offered on the market. The rangeland is in excellent condition and is rated to support around 250 head. Elevations range from approximately 5500 feet to 6100 feet. Livestock water is supplied by three wells - two solar, and one windmill. Multiple storage tanks and an extensive pipeline system feed the numerous drinkers. There are also several well-placed dirt tanks. Livestock handling equipment includes pipe and railroad tie corrals and scales at the headquarters. Other improvements include a modest caretakers house, a charming old rock house and shop, and an old metal and frame barn. The property has four wind turbines, and the wind lease generates over $50,000 annually. Wildlife enthusiasts and hunters will enjoy the pronghorn, mule deer, and other wildlife roaming this expansive landscape. Conveniently positioned just a short 30-mile drive from Interstate 40 and the vibrant community of Santa Rosa, the Martinez Pintada Ranch offers both seclusion and accessibility. With dramatic landscapes and natural beauty, this working cattle ranch presents a rare and compelling opportunity in the heart of New Mexico's ranching country.
